It's Cactus: Your source for Haitian metal sculptures and other Fair Trade folk art from Haiti. Whether it is for your home or garden, metal wall art is universally wonderful! Haitian metal art is handmade by village artisans and created from recycled metal steel oil drums. Most importantly tho, it is Fair Trade, so everyone benefits, including you!
And that's not all! You will also find fabulous Latin American folk art. There is everything from carved wooden Santos and textiles from Guatemala, mantas and masks from Bolivia, ceramic art from Mexico, retablos from Peru, painted furniture from Ecuador, and authentic Day of the Dead decor from throughout the region.
